Did You Know/Interesting Facts:

 

1. Brass has been used for centuries in various cultures around the world due to its durability and aesthetic appeal.

 

2. In Kerala, India, brass measuring vessels, known as "para," hold significant cultural and religious importance and are often used in rituals and ceremonies.

 

3. Brass measuring vessels are not only practical for measuring ingredients but also serve as symbols of hospitality and tradition in many households.

  • All the brass has been lacquered.Lacquer is a thin, shiny layer that helps to prevent tarnish.Use dry or wet cotton cloth to remove dirt.Do not clean with harsh chemicals.If you have any doubts consider taking the brass piece in for a professional polish to gain back the original look.
